Abstract

We employ a recent technique based on a semigroup application of the method of types to improve on a second-order converse for the common randomness (CR) generation problem. The previously known bound lead to a correct second-order asymptotic rate, but incorrect sign on the second-order term for error rates below 1/2. The new bound has both the correct scaling and sign of the second-order term for small enough error rates.
